7 Top Trekking Destinations in Uttarakhand for Adventure and Nature Lovers

Uttarakhand, a tranquil state in northern India, is heaven for nature lovers and trekkers alike. From the majestic Himalayas to lush meadows, Uttarakhand’s trekking trails are unbeatable in terms of scenery and adventure. Whether you are a beginner or an experienced trekker, there is something for everyone here. Let us take a look at the 7 best trekking destinations of Uttarakhand that provide scenic beauty, tranquility, and adventure.

1. Valley of Flowers Trek – A UNESCO World Heritage Jewel

Valley of Flowers Trek is one of the most beautiful trekking spots of Uttarakhand. It is a moderately challenging trek that is a stroll along a breathtaking valley of rainbow-colored alpine flowers, waterfalls, and glaciers.
• Trek Duration: 6–7 days
• Best Time to Visit: July to September
• Special Highlight: Spotting rare Himalayan flowers and the endangered blue poppy.
The trek comes under the Nanda Devi Biosphere Reserve and is a paradise for nature lovers and photographers.

2. Kedarkantha Trek – Uttarakhand Winter Wonderland

The Kedarkantha Trek is among the best winter treks in Uttarakhand. It is covered with snow, and the trek offers breathtaking scenery of snow-clad mountains and peaceful pine forests.
• Trek Duration: 5–6 days
• Best Time to Visit: December to April
•Special Feature: 360-degree view of the mountains from the top.
Kedarkantha is ideal for beginners and is typically chosen for snow trekking training courses.

3. Roopkund Trek – Mystery of the Skeleton Lake

Adventure and mystery lovers should go for the Roopkund Trek. This high-altitude trek gets you to Roopkund Lake, which is famous for the discovery of ancient human skeletons on its shores.
•Trek Duration: 8–9 days
•Optimum Time to Travel: May to June & September to October
•Special Attraction: The lake, glaciers, and views of the mountains.
Being one of the most demanding trekking places of Uttarakhand, Roopkund is a trekker’s paradise.

4. Har Ki Dun Trek – The Valley of Gods

Har Ki Dun Trek in Garhwal Himalayas provides a glimpse of vintage Himalayan villages, fields, woods teeming with bird and wildlife life.
•Trekking Time: 7–8 days
•Best Time to Visit: March to June and September to December
•Special Attraction: Peaceful atmosphere, wooden village cottages, and scenery of Swargarohini peak.
It is one of the oldest and most culturally rich trekking destinations of Uttarakhand.

5. Nag Tibba Trek – Perfect Weekend Destination

In case you don’t have much time but miss out on the mountain scenery, Nag Tibba Trek is your best bet. Nearest to Mussoorie, the trek is a cakewalk and takes around two days to finish. The trek is an easy-to-moderate one that is suitable for families.
•Trek Day: 2 days
•Best Time to Visit: October to March
•Special Feature: Scenic views of Bandarpunch and Kedarnath peaks.
Nag Tibba is a place to go among Uttarakhand trekking destinations in search of a quick and refreshing getaway.

6. Pindari Glacier Trek – A Glacier Trek

To experience trekking along rivers and glaciers, the Pindari Glacier Trek is a worth-it option. The trek follows the Pindar River and ends at the scenic Pindari Glacier.
•Trek Duration: 7–9 days
•Best Time to Visit: May to October
•Special Highlight: Himalayan wildlife, scenic villages, and views of glaciers.
This trek is typically recommended to the tourists visiting glacier-based trekking destinations of Uttarakhand.

7. Gaumukh Tapovan Trek – A Spiritual and Scenic Trail

Gaumukh Tapovan Trek combines adventure with spirituality. From Gangotri, the trek extends to the Gaumukh Glacier, which is the origin of divine Ganges River.
•Trek Duration: 7–8 days
•Best Time to Visit: May to June and September to October
•Special Highlight: Close-up photography of Shivling and Bhagirathi peaks.
Most visited pilgrims’ trail, one of Uttarakhand’s holiest trekking sites.

Pre-Trek Tips

  • Keep an eye on weather and trail conditions in advance.
  • Hire a local guide with a license or a trekking group.
  • Take necessary equipment like warm clothing, trekking shoes, and water.
  • Be courteous to the local culture and don’t litter.
